Moonlighter is a Much Better Game Than I Thought

The game Moonlighter is a combination rogue-lite dungeon-crawler mixed with trade simulation and story-rich RPG elements. This timeless, beautifully rendered pixel top-down was released by Digital Sun in 2018, and is available on most platforms.

Demetrios: The BIG Cynical Adventure Requires Some Decent Puzzle Solving Skills

Demetrios: The BIG Cynical Adventure is an indie interactive-fiction/visual novel cartoon adventure. The interactive feature is much like you'd see in a hidden object story as well, although clues that you find unlock different possibilities. The story is very comical on purpose and can get as fresh out of the outhouse as you please. Despite this, it is a very well-thought-out mystery story about a complex theft and the clues can leave you curious about what's around every corner.

A Bird Story is a Classic and Influential Indie

This one in particular is about a young boy who rescues an injured bird in the forest near his school. More specifically, he fends off a badger which tries to catch the bird in a forest clearing. The rest of the story flows organically from this incident and it is the primary purpose of the narrative.
